Show 18 Vernal Expren Wednesday, July 25, 1S90 West Vernall E m Vernal Blue Minors win 2nd Utah So West Jordan survived games with Richfield, Orem Southeast, Delta, and Vernal Blue to win the Utah South State Bambino Minor title and advance to the Pacific Southwest Regional to be held at Hillcrest Union beginning August 4. The Pacific Southwest Regional is just one step from the World Series to be held at Long view, Washington beginning August 11. Vernal Blue, the surprise team of the tournament in only its first year of Babe Ruth action, beat West Jordan 1 in the opener and then lost to Orem Southeast, before rebounding re-bounding with wins over Richfield, Orem Northeast, Orem Southeast, and Delta to gain a spot in the title contest. In the title contest, West Jordan opened with 8 in the first inning and Vernal was set in a catchup role the rest of the game which ended 18-8 in four innings. In the end it was too little, too late for Vcmal which had to move through the tough loser bracket to get to the final game. The winner West Jordan played only three games in five days to get to the title game whereas Vernal and those in the loser bracket had six in five days including a double header the day before the game. Take nothing away from West Jordan, they are a great little team, but give Vernal a days rest and the outcome wouldn't have been so lopsided. lop-sided. After the near disastrous first inning in-ning which Vernal trailed 8-2 in, Vernal made a comeback in the second sec-ond to close the gap to 8-7. I Iowcvcr, West Jordan then promptly prompt-ly answered with 8 more in their half of the inning to open a 16-7 lead which Vcmal never recovered from. West Jordan will not advance to the rcgionals where they will represent repre-sent Utah South against state champions cham-pions from California, Guam, Washington, Oregon, Idaho, Montana, Wyoming, Nevada, Utah North, and Arizona. ARCHERY UARTtRS Best Selection Service and Price! 1 - i ft VERNAL BLUE Bambino Minor League All-Star Team took second at the Utah South State Tournament Tour-nament last weekend in Vernal, falling victim to Orem SE early and West Jordan in the Championship Cham-pionship game. The team pictured here are: front row (l-r) Brett Johnston, Danny Allen, Cory Kebert, Jon Muir, Garett Klun, Greg Atwood, and Jon Workman. Middle row are: (l-r) Ryan Lewis, Andy Long, Shane Kidd, Steve Hatch, Bryce Atwood, Kevin Carter, and Clint Peterson. Peter-son.
